What is a Part Time SDET job?

A Part-Time SDET (Software Development Engineer in Test) is responsible for designing, developing, and maintaining automated testing frameworks and scripts while working on a reduced schedule. They collaborate with developers to ensure software quality by identifying bugs and performance issues. This role typically requires proficiency in programming languages like Python, Java, or C#, as well as experience with testing tools like Selenium or Cypress. Part-time SDETs are often hired by companies that need flexible quality assurance support without a full-time commitment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Part Time Sdet position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Part Time SDET (Software Development Engineer in Test), you need a solid grounding in software development, automated testing frameworks, and debugging, typically backed by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with tools such as Selenium, JUnit, TestNG, and experience with programming languages like Java, Python, or C# are often required, alongside knowledge of CI/CD systems. Strong analytical thinking, communication skills, and the ability to manage time effectively distinguish top candidates in this part-time capacity. These skills ensure high-quality software releases, enhance team collaboration, and make a real impact even within limited working hours.

What are the typical responsibilities of a Part Time SDET, and how do they contribute to the overall development team?

As a Part Time SDET, your primary responsibilities usually include designing, developing, and executing automated test scripts, as well as identifying and documenting bugs to improve software quality. You’ll collaborate closely with developers, QA engineers, and product managers to ensure requirements are understood and thoroughly tested within sprints or release cycles. Even on a part-time schedule, your contributions help catch issues early, speed up development processes, and maintain high software standards. This role is an excellent way to gain hands-on experience in both programming and quality assurance while working in a flexible environment.
